Ingredients
– 8 oz. penne pasta
– 1 lb. Italian sausage (sweet or spicy)
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 cup heavy cream
– 1 cup chicken broth
– 1 cup spinach, fresh
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
– 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
– Salt and black pepper, to taste
– Fresh basil, for garnish (optional)
Instructions
Making Tuscan Sausage Pasta in Creamy Sauce is a breeze when you follow these easy steps:
1. Cook the Pasta: In a large pot, boil salted water and cook the penne p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2. Brown the Sausage: In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the Italian sausage, breaking it up with a wooden spoon. Cook until browned and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
3. Sauté Garlic: Add the min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ant.
4. Add Broth and Cream: Pour in the chicken broth and heavy cream, stirring to combine.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
5. Incorporate Vegetables: Add the spinach and cherry tomatoes to the skillet. Allow them to wilt and cook for about 3-4 minutes.
6. Mix in Pasta: Add the cooked penne pasta to the skillet, tossing everything together until well combined.
7. Add Cheese and Seasonings: Stir in the grated Parmesan cheese, Italian seasoning, salt, and black pepper. Mix until the cheese melts into the sauce.
8. Simmer: Let the pasta cook in the sauce for an additional 2-3 minutes until everything is heated through.
9. Serve: Remove from heat and serve the pasta warm, garnished with fresh basil if desired.

-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 4
- Calories: 600 kcal
- Fat: 28g
- Protein: 25g
